CHARGING CABLE
EMERGENCY
UNLOCK (electric
versions)
If the charging cable does not unlock at
the end of the charging procedure, you
can unlock it manually.
If, after closing and opening the doors
by pressing the respective buttons
/ / located on the key and having
made sure that the charging has been
interrupted, it is still not possible to
remove the charging cable from the
port on the vehicle, turn the ignition
device to the MAR position and then
turn it back to the STOP position.
If it is not yet possible to remove the
charging cable from the port on the
vehicle, it is possible to act manually by
operating a special emergency release
device located on the lower fig. 317
left central pillar and carrying out the
operations described below:
pull out the cap (A) fig. 317;
pull the cord to manually unlock the
actuator of the charging socket;
pull out the charging connector out
of the charging port located on the
vehicle;
correctly reposition the cord and the
hook in their housing.
NOTE To restore correct operation of
the system, contact a Dealership.

CHARGING
FUNCTIONS
(electric versions)
CHARGING SCHEDULE
Two charging modes are available:
immediate and scheduled.
The two charging modes can be
selected in two ways:
via the dedicated smartphone app
(refer to the "Connected Services"
chapter in the "Multimedia" section)
(where provided)
by means of the multimedia system.
The page available on the multimedia
system can be used to set charging
times when the vehicle will be charged
via Mode 2 or Mode 3. By acting on
the multimedia system display and
selecting the "Charging schedule"
function on the screen under the
"Vehicle" page (fig. 318) you can set
the start and end time at which the
high-voltage battery is to be charged.
The end time of each charging interval
can be set as "charge to completion",
in which case the end time will be
deselected. For more information,
see "Settings" in the "Vehicle mode"
paragraph in the "Multimedia" section).
NOTE DC recharging (Mode 4) does
not include hourly programming.

USING SCHEDULED
CHARGING
After programming and selecting the
desired charging intervals (up to a
maximum of two), plug in the charging
cable, following the charging procedure
indicated in the "Alternating current
(AC) charging at home", "Fast home
charging procedure from wallbox
charging station", "Charging procedure
from public charging station (AC)"
sections. Charging will start at the
selected time.
